Nothing OS 5.0 drops with Android 17 and on-device app building

What you need to know

  • Nothing OS 5.0 is here and combines a redesigned interface, deeper customization, smoother performance, and upgraded Essential AI tools.
  • Transparent widgets, wallpaper-adaptive icon colors, the new Geist typeface, and refreshed system icons give Nothing OS a more cohesive look.
  • Nothing OS 5.0 Open Beta begins for the Phone (3), with a stable release expected in mid-October and more devices joining the beta later.

Nothing is giving its software a substantial refresh with Nothing OS 5.0, a major update built on Android 17. The latest software zeroes in on everyday interactions, blending a redesigned visual system with more customization, smoother performance, and more powerful Essential AI tools.

The update is all about giving you more control and a smoother experience. The home screen gets a brand new theme with transparent widgets and a search bar that adds some depth, while app icons can now pull subtle color tints from your wallpaper to match your vibe.

There’s a new system typeface, Geist, which is cleaner and easier to scan, and refreshed icons across the status bar, Settings, Camera, and Gallery. The Gallery also includes new options for sorting and filtering to help you organize photos.

You also get more ways to make the phone yours. The lock screen has two new clock faces: the whimsical “Gooey” and the hardware-inspired « Micrographics. » Please note the Micrographics clockface and the new home screen theme are still in development and will not be available in the Open Beta yet — they will be part of the general release starting October.

The Glyph Interface now comes in an app, so all the features and sounds are in one place. There is also a new Glyph Timer widget and the Away Time widget that helps you monitor your digital habits by telling you how long you’ve been away from your phone.

Nothing is also doubling down on its Essential AI tools. Essential Voice is faster, real-time transcriptions are better, and with the Ear (3), you can record audio directly from the Super Mic on the case. Smart Collections can suggest and organize content for you automatically. And for a fun twist, you can now create Essential Apps right on your phone; just tell it what you want in plain language and it’ll build it for you.

Since it runs on Android 17, you get the latest features of the platform as well. That includes the capability to split out the notifications and Quick Settings panels and an enhanced Quick Share that works across iOS and Android via QR code. The update also brings new privacy indicators, expanded dark theme support, and a redesigned Recents menu.

The Nothing OS 5.0 Open Beta program starts today for the Phone (3), with a stable release expected in mid-October. Other devices will be included in the beta program later.
